    Rail-Based System for Vehicles and Aircraft

    A rail-based system is basically the units roll smoothly along as if they are attached to a rail, such as a train or roller coaster. They maintain uniform spacing with other units in the same group and maintain a consistent speed along the designated route. For aircraft, it is the same - the units will progress along the intended path (waypoints in the editor) and land exactly where you tell them to, regardless of the situation on the ground. Even with extreme scripting this simply is not possible in the current game engine. While some may get close, it is never spot-on, and is always inconsistent - factors that make the effort to script daunting to say the least.
